How is cooperation between national institutions ensured in the fight against money laundering in Guatemala?
In Guatemala, a legal framework and coordination mechanisms have been established to ensure cooperation between national institutions in the fight against money laundering. There are information exchange protocols, coordination committees and dialogue spaces that facilitate collaboration between entities such as the Public Ministry, the FIU, the SIB and other relevant institutions.
What is Paraguay's approach to AML regulation in the online gambling sector?
The online gambling sector in Paraguay is also subject to AML regulations. Companies operating in this sector must perform due diligence in identifying their customers and reporting suspicious transactions to prevent money laundering.

What is the impact of corruption and money laundering on access to basic services and fundamental rights in Honduras?
Corruption and money laundering have a negative impact on access to basic services and fundamental rights in Honduras. Corruption can divert resources intended for the provision of essential services, such as education, health, housing and drinking water. This limits the population's access to these services and perpetuates inequality and social exclusion. Furthermore, corruption can create barriers and obstacles to the exercise of fundamental rights, such as access to justice and political participation. Money laundering can also have a direct impact on people's quality of life, as illicit funds stolen from the economy may have originally been used for investments and social programs. To guarantee equitable access to basic services and fundamental rights, it is essential to prevent and punish corruption, strengthen the institutions in charge of providing public services and promote transparency and accountability in their management.
